Man unconscious with possible drug overdose in Texas, Johnson County TX
A 45-year-old man was found unconscious with difficulty breathing near Alabama St, Texas. CPR was performed and a heartbeat was restored, but the man remained unconscious. The patient showed pinpoint pupils indicating a possible drug overdose. No Narcan was available at the scene.
